About This Work

This large, voluptuous nude depicts Marie-Thérèse Walter reclining on a black couch, her body rendered in the biomorphic, sensual forms that characterize Picasso's most celebrated period. The contrast between the warm flesh tones and the black couch creates a dramatic visual tension, while the figure's relaxed, sleeping pose suggests complete vulnerability and trust.

Painted in the same extraordinary year as Le Rêve and Nude, Green Leaves and Bust, this work belongs to the series of large-scale nudes that represent the peak of Picasso's Surrealist period. The 1932 series is considered among the greatest achievements in the history of figure painting.
